Convert Kilosiemens to Megasiemens
Convert Kilosiemens (kS) to Megasiemens (MS) instantly and accurately.
Conversion Formula
MS = kS × 0.001
About Kilosiemens
The kilosiemens (kS) equals 10³ S, encountered in high-conductance metallic connections and power-semiconductor on-state characterisation. About Megasiemens
The megasiemens (MS) equals 10⁶ S, the scale for very-low-resistance metallic structures such as thick busbars and short heavy-gauge connectors.
